On a form 1 the host firearm MUST already be on the schedule A that you mail in. People have been getting their forms kicked back without it
If you already have a suppressor in a trust then I'd go that route. No finger prints and No CLEO sig.
Include:
2 copies of the form one printed front and back
1 Cert of compliance
1 copy of your trust with the notary visible
1 updated schedule A
